**Purpose**:
The (Associate) Education Economist conducts, within multi-disciplinary teams, the viability of investment projects and programmes in particular related to the Education sector as well as investments in Public Research. S/he would assess the financial, economic, technical, social and environmental viability of investment projects and programmes in all countries where the Bank operates, in accordance with the Bank's and Projects Directorate’s procedures. S/he would also carry out in-depth sectoral and economic research and/or policy papers in support of the Bank's sector and lending policies.

**Operating Network**:
The (Associate) Education Economist will report to the Head of Division and work in close contact or under the supervision of the executive staff of the Innovation and Competitiveness Department, and broadly within Projects directorate. In addition, close work and cooperation with other parts of the Bank is envisaged, notably those participating in lending operations and advisory work. S/he will need to work with a high degree of autonomy and with strong collaborative attitude, also maintaining external contacts with private organisations, public authorities and EU institutions, as appropriate.

**Accountabilities**:
As part of a multi-disciplinary team, the (Associate) Education Economist will:

- Evaluate the strategic coherence, as well as assess the economic viability, social impact and sustainability of investment projects, including the assessment of investments in tangible and intangible assets related to Education and Public Research.
- Prepare sector, policy and methodology papers related to the sector of her/his responsibility in support of the Bank's lending policies and assist in identifying investments representing new financing opportunities in these sectors.
- Monitor project implementation, including final evaluation of project completion and further project follow-up when required.
- Maintain external contacts, including the corresponding units in the European Commission, other international bodies, specialised institutes and IFIs as well as active representation at selected sector events.
- If need arises, support of other sectors within the department may be required, which involves an open mind-set and high degree of flexibility.
- Willingness to travel also to countries outside the EU.

**Qualifications**:

- University degree (minimum an equivalent to a Masters) ideally in Economics, Education, Social Studies, or in another related field.
- A minimum of 3 years relevant professional experience, i.e. in academia, educational or training institutions, IFIs, independent research institutions, or consultancy firms.
- Demonstrable knowledge and experience about aspects related to research, innovation and/or social inclusiveness would be an advantage.
- Knowledge of economic and financial project appraisal and modelling would be an advantage.
- Knowledge of EU policies on Education, Training, Research, and Innovation would be an advantage.
- Exposure and ability to operate in multicultural environments would be an advantage.
- Excellent knowledge of English and/or French (**), with a good command of the other. Knowledge of other EU languages would be an advantage.
